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
796 6512939170 5855 452 453790557
305692098 3796153789
305692098 3796153789
693441032 45917 944 4574547
All about undefined
Interested in learning more?
305692098 3796153789
693441032 45917 944 4574547
See more
0504656 066797088
0412893405 7717911 625 05054 05115
See more
99 293645 9640620728
991 95628 1781318
See more